because it excites me, here are the notes from the first production meeting for A/other Lover being presented by LiveWire Chicago Theatre at the Side Project Theatre February 8 - 18, 2007.
-
Production Meeting #1
September 25, 2006
6:30 p.m.
Joshua Weinstein – Writer/Director
Rebekah Johnson – Stage Manager/Assistant Director
David Stoughton – Lighting Designer
Aleks Zarnitsyn – Sound Designer
Erin Barlow – Costumes/Cherry
Josh will take care of the Set design
David will assist him on Set and Props
Set:
4 Acting Spaces for the 4 characters
Joe & Gina – Married/Bedroom – Neat/Tidy space
Ian & Cherry – Cherry is shacked up with Ian/Ian’s Condo – Cluttered scripts and junk everywhere
Gina – Writing desk/boudoir
Joe – Bed/T.V.
--Space is shifted--
Ian – Shelf unit/wall full of books
Cherry – Desk/Phone
-Camera Crew – Possibility
-Two High Rise apartments
-Windows with lights coming thru
-City at night
-High up in the high rise
-Faint city noises
-Naturalistic
-Roman Numerals/Split up
-Isolation of characters within light
Costumes:
Joe – Blue Collar
Ian – Writer but not emphasized
Gina: Simple, but feminine
